BIO

Penny Harris is a Senior Lecturer at the University of Wollongong and teaches into the Visual Arts program. Her creative practice and research is grounded in metal casting and material mimicry. She casts found objects and petrifies them using a lost wax casting process and has adapted a bricolage construction technique to assemble the objects once cast. Her practice is underpinned by an interest in visual poetic narrative including archaeological histories and objects interpreted through cast textiles and found objects as project based wall installation. Penny uses the sculptural objects to construct a fragmented poetic wall story that re-interprets the narrative strategies developed by the postmodern novelists. She exhibits in Canada and Australia.
